Wills Wing donates $1000 to the 2009 US National Team
Wills Wing has donated $1000 to the US National hang gliding team to help offset their expenses at the upcoming Worlds in France. The expenses will be considerable (but then the enjoyment will also be considerable), and the team very much appreciates the help from Wills Wing and others.
Steve Kroop at Flytec is also a big supporter and has paid most of the cost for our new US National Team tee-shirts. More on this below. Thanks again to the Foundation for Free Flight for paying for our registration.
The team also appreciates the donation from Doug Koch. Other USHPA pilots (and others, of course) and invited to help support the team in its "real" effort this year to get the team on the podium.
We know that in this era of an economic depression it probably seems like a frivolity to send a team to the World Championships when there will be so many other demands for our resources and attention. I like to think that we should continue to look out and not withdraw into ourselves as things get tight. Flying and competing provides a "heroic" perspective that uplifts us all and encourages the best parts of our human nature.
